1. Understanding Your Needs

Before starting your search, it is essential to identify exactly what your family needs. This step prevents confusion later and ensures you hire someone who is compatible with your household.

a) Type of Nanny

Live-in nanny: Resides in your home. Offers full-time care and is often available during emergencies. Ideal for infants and busy households.

Come-and-go nanny: Works during specified hours and leaves afterward. Suitable for older children or families with flexible schedules.

b) Child’s Age and Needs

Infant care requires a nanny with specialized training in newborn care, feeding, and sleep schedules.

Toddlers may need educational play, potty training, and supervision.

Older children might require homework assistance, school pick-up, and after-school activities.

c) Special Requirements

Medical knowledge or first aid training

Ability to cook healthy meals

Knowledge of bilingual or multilingual childcare

Experience with special needs children

d) Work Schedule

Decide on full-time, part-time, or flexible hours.

Plan for holidays, sick days, and extra hours.

Tip: Writing a clear job description at this stage will save you time and frustration later. Include your expectations for childcare, chores, and any special skills required.

3. The Vetting Process

Safety is paramount. A professional nanny must be vetted properly before entering your home.

a) Identity Verification

Verify government-issued IDs.

Cross-check references provided by the nanny.

b) Police Clearance

Ensure the nanny has a Certificate of Good Conduct or police clearance.

c) Reference Checks

Contact previous employers to confirm reliability and experience.

d) Training Verification

Ask for certificates in first aid, child care, hygiene, and nutrition.

Tip: Never skip background checks. Parents should also trust their instincts; if something feels off, keep searching.

4. Interviewing the Nanny

Interviews help assess personality, experience, and suitability.

Sample Questions

1. How do you handle tantrums or difficult behavior?

2. Can you prepare meals for children?

3. What activities do you do to stimulate learning in toddlers?

4. Have you handled emergencies before?

5. What strategies do you use to ensure child safety?

 

Observation Tip: If possible, let the nanny interact with your child during the interview. Observe how they communicate, show patience, and engage with your child.

5. Trial Period

A trial period ensures compatibility before committing long-term.

Duration: Typically 1–2 weeks

Monitor: Punctuality, reliability, interaction with your child, and adherence to rules

Feedback: Give constructive feedback to guide the nanny

Tip: Keep communication professional but friendly. This helps the nanny adjust quickly while setting boundaries.

6. Contracts and Agreements

A written contract protects both parties. Include:

Work schedule and hours

Duties and responsibilities

Leave days and holidays

Termination clauses

Pro Tip: Professional agencies provide legally compliant templates. Always follow Kenyan labor laws to avoid disputes.
